FINALLY! A Self-opening can opener that WORKS!

But please note that I received this item for free in exchange for my honest review. === Review begins: I have gone through several of these that claimed to be the be-all to end-all of self-opening can openers, and they were NOT. So I have to admit that I went in with a skeptical mindset when I got this to review. I was wrong. This product, made by Zyliss actually lives up to it's name. We made pozole tonight for dinner, and for 12 hearty eaters, this meant 2 #10 cans of hominy. So I took out the EasiCan, put in the batteries, and watched it do it's magic. And in under 90 seconds both cans were opened, and because of how it opens the cans, no sharp edges. You simply place the unit on the can with the cutting wheel on the OUTSIDE of the can rim, press the button, and watch it walk around the can. When you hear the can pop, it is finished. Just press the button again and wait 3 seconds for it to stop. That IS the only drawback, that it does not have a sensor so that when the can is open it auto-stops. But it makes a nice safe edge, and the built-in magnet lifts the lid right off the can. It works with any size can (we cheated and had canned refried beans tonight as a side, in a standard 30 ounce can) and leaves the edge smooth. It's safe enough for kids to use, under adult guidance, and it's a breeze to clean up. Just pop out the batteries, remove the front edge and clean any gunk from the label off the cutting wheel. Snap it back together, and you are ready for the next time. I have spent well over $100 on these type of openers and have ended up returning them or throwing them out. This one, and it's sisters that I am ordering for all 4 units of the four-plex, have a home with us. Uses 2 AA batteries, not included, but just search here on Amazon and you can find them in bulk, which is how we buy batteries anyhow. It's not the cheapest of the automatic openers, but it works.... and that makes it worth the few extra dollars.
